I have DLL Authentication enabled in Sygate Personal Firewall Pro and MPC has reportedly attempted to send outgoing traffic 3 times during normal AVI playback in the last 36 hours.

Application has changed since the last time you opened it, process id: 1832

Filename: C:\Program Files\Media Player Classic\Media Player Classic.exe

The change was denied by user

---- Modules changed: 1 ----

C:\Program Files\Media Player Classic\Media Player Classic.exe

---- New modules: 0 ----

Severity = Major

Direction = Outgoing

Protocol = None

Remote Host = 0.0.0.0

Anything to be concerned about?


Posted (edited)

In the player go to View\Options\Tweaks

Check for the settings Send "Now Playing" ....

This is enabled by default and can be VERY embarrassing

depending on the title you're watching !

My Media Player Classic is from the K-Lite codec pack, never had any problems with outgoing traffic...

its nothing major, but check

Player -> keys and uncheck the WinLIRC and uICE boxes (unless you have a controller that needs them)

and also check

Player -> Web Interface and look to see if you have the listen on port box checked or not.
